Indonesia's 2025 crypto tax revenue reaches $47 million: Southeast Asia market is awakening
The Indonesian government recently announced the 2025 cryptocurrency market data, providing a clear picture of this Southeast Asian nation’s crypto ecosystem for the first time. With a trading volume of $31 billion to $32 billion, 19.2 million investors, and $47 million in tax revenue—these figures reflect a rapidly growing market.
The True Scale of Indonesia’s Crypto Market

What do these numbers indicate? First, a trading volume of $31 billion to $32 billion has reached a considerable scale. In Southeast Asia, this volume demonstrates the importance of the Indonesian market. Second, a base of 19.2 million investors suggests that cryptocurrencies are no longer a niche topic in Indonesia but have entered the mainstream investment options.
The Actual Effectiveness of Tax Policy Enforcement
The $47 million in tax revenue may seem modest, but it reflects the practical enforcement of Indonesia’s crypto regulatory policies. This figure indicates that the Indonesian government is not only formulating cryptocurrency tax policies but also actively promoting compliance.
Indonesia’s attitude toward cryptocurrencies is relatively open. As one of Southeast Asia’s largest economies, it is regulating the market and attracting legitimate investments through tax policies. From the perspective of tax revenue, this shows that a significant portion of market transactions are already integrated into the government’s tax system.
Another Dimension of Market Activity
The 19.2 million investors are particularly noteworthy. Considering Indonesia’s total population of approximately 270 million, this means about 7.5% of the population holds or has traded cryptocurrencies. This ratio is not low on a global scale.
Supporting a trading volume of $31 billion to $32 billion with so many investors indicates a highly active market. The average annual trading volume per investor is around $150,000 to $160,000, reflecting that this is not just a retail market but also includes a considerable number of institutional and active traders.
Future Trends of the Indonesian Market
Based on current data, Indonesia’s crypto market is transitioning from rapid growth to a more regulated development stage. The government’s tax policies are neither suppressive nor entirely permissive but aim to guide market compliance through taxation.
This attitude suggests several possible development directions: first, the market size is expected to continue expanding as the government’s relatively open policies attract more legitimate participants; second, compliant exchanges and service providers will have more opportunities as investors seek formal channels; third, market transparency will gradually improve as tax compliance requirements promote the disclosure of trading data.
